She's back with a brand new upgrade – mini maniac M3GAN returns for an all new chapter of AI mayhem in Blumhouse's sequel M3GAN 2.0, with the first official teaser dropping today ahead of a June 27 theatrical release.
M3GAN's Gerard Johnstone returns as director, with Akela Cooper back on script duties. Horror titan James Wan returns to produce via Atomic Monster.
Allison Williams (Get Out), Violet McGraw (The Haunting of Hill House) and Amie Donald and Jenna Davis, as M3GAN's body and voice respectively, all return to star in the follow-up to the 2023 horror hit, with Ivanna Sakhno (Star Wars Ahsoka series), joining as a newfound threat to M3GAN's reign of terror:
Two years after M3GAN, a marvel of artificial intelligence, went rogue and embarked on a murderous (and impeccably choreographed) rampage and was subsequently destroyed, M3GAN’s creator Gemma (Williams) has become a high-profile author and advocate for government oversight of A.I. Meanwhile, Gemma’s niece Cady (McGraw), now 14, has become a teenager, rebelling against Gemma’s overprotective rules.
Unbeknownst to them, the underlying tech for M3GAN has been stolen and misused by a powerful defense contractor to create a military-grade weapon known as Amelia (Sakhno), the ultimate killer infiltration spy. But as Amelia’s self-awareness increases, she becomes decidedly less interested in taking orders from humans. Or in keeping them around. With the future of human existence on the line, Gemma realizes that the only option is to resurrect M3GAN (Amie Donald, voiced by Jenna Davis) and give her a few upgrades, making her faster, stronger, and more lethal. As their paths collide, the original A.I bitch is about to meet her match.
The M3GAN universe is also set to expand with its first spinoff movie, SOULM8TE from director Kate Dolan (You Are Not My Mother) and starring Evil Dead Rise‘s Lily Sullivan, billed for release on January 2, 2026.
